/* IMPORTANT */
/* This design is not a template. You may not reproduce it elsewhere without the 
   designer's written permission. However, feel free to study the CSS and use 
   techniques you learn from it elsewhere. */



/* ----- BASICS ELEMENTS ------------------------------------------------------------------------------------------------- */
body { 
	
	background-color: #CCFFFF; 
	font: 14px Tahoma, Helvetica, sans-serif;
	color: #000000;	

		
	}
ul, li {

	margin: 0px 0px 0px 8px; 
	padding: 0px;
}

p { 
	padding: 0px;
	font: 14px Tahoma; 
	margin-top: 8px;
	margin-bottom: 15px;
	color: #000000;	
	/*text-align: justify;*/
	}

h1,h2,h3 {
	margin-top: 15px;
	padding: 0px;
	}



.searchBox {
	margin-top:3px;
	background:#ffffff;
	height:15px;
	font-family: Arial, Helvetica, sans-serif;
	font-size: 12px;
	border:none;
	
	color:#2143ae;
	border-style:solid;
	border-color: #cacaca;
	border-width:1px;
	*margin-top:6px;
	*height:15px;
}




a:link {
	  font-family : Tahoma,Verdana,Arial;
    text-decoration: underline;
    color: #0000FF;
    font-size : 12px;
}

a:hover {
    color: #0000FF;
}


a:active {
    color: #0000FF;
}



.backmenu		{font-family :Trebuchet MS, arial,helvetica; ;font-size : 11px; color : #ff0000;text-decoration: none;}
a.backmenu		{uppercase;font-family : Trebuchet MS, arial,helvetica; ;font-size : 11px; color : #ff0000;text-decoration: none;}
a.backmenu:hover	{uppercase;font-family: Trebuchet MS, arial,helvetica; ;font-size :  11px; color : #808080;text-decoration: none;}


.footermenu			{font-family :Trebuchet MS, arial,helvetica; ;font-size : 11px; color : #ffffff;text-decoration: none;}
a.footermenu		{uppercase;font-family : Trebuchet MS, arial,helvetica; ;font-size : 11px; color : #ffffff;text-decoration: none;}
a.footermenu:hover	{uppercase;font-family: Trebuchet MS, arial,helvetica; ;font-size :  11px; color : #808080;text-decoration: none;}



.nutritrionClick			{font-family : Verdana,tahoma,Arial;font-size : 10px; color : #FF0000;text-decoration: underline;}
a.nutritrionClick			{font-family : Verdana,tahoma,Arial;font-size : 10px; color : #FF0000;text-decoration: underline;}
a.nutritrionClick:hover	{font-family: Verdana,tahoma,Arial;font-size : 10px; color : #000000;text-decoration: underline;}


.flavorLink				{font-family :Arial,helvetica; ;font-size : 16px; color : #0000ff;text-decoration: underline;font-weight: bold;}
a.flavorLink			{font-family :Arial,helvetica; ;font-size : 16px; color : #0000ff;text-decoration: underline;font-weight: bold;}
a.flavorLink:hover		{font-family :Arial,helvetica; ;font-size : 16px; color : #08727c;text-decoration: underline;font-weight: bold;}


/*blue*/



/*

.style1 {font-family: Tahoma, Arial, Helvetica;	font-size: 12px; color: #353434;}
.style2 {font-family: Tahoma, Arial, Helvetica;	font-weight: bold;	font-size: 16px;	color: #CC0000;}
.style3 {font-family: Tahoma, Arial, Helvetica;	font-weight: bold;	font-size: 16px;	color: #353434;}
.style4 {font-family: Tahoma, Arial, Helvetica; font-size: 12px; color: #353434; }
.style5 {color: #000000; font-family: Tahoma, Arial, Helvetica, sans-serif; font-size: 12px;}
.style6 {color: #FF0000; font-family:  Tahoma, Arial, Helvetica, sans-serif; font-size: 12px;}
.style7 {color: #666666; font-family:  Tahoma, Arial, Helvetica, sans-serif; font-size: 12px;}
.style8 {color: #FFFFFF; font-family: Tahoma, Arial, Helvetica, sans-serif; font-size: 12px;}
.alert		{font-family:verdana,tahoma,arial,helvetica; font-size:10px;color:#e5181e;}
*/

td.topContact {font: 14px Arial, Helvetica, sans-serif; color: #08727c;font-weight: bold;}  /*Teal headeline*/
td.flavorMonth {font: 26px Tahoma, Helvetica, sans-serif; color: #312e2e; font-weight: bold;line-height: 17px;}
td.flavorofMonthTitle {font: 24px Tahoma, Helvetica, sans-serif; color: #312e2e;font-weight: bold;}  /*grey headeline*/
td.flavorofMonth {font: 18px Tahoma, Helvetica, sans-serif; color: #08727c;font-weight: bold;line-height: 16px;}  /*Teal headeline*/


.style1 {font: 14px Arial, Helvetica, sans-serif; color: #08727c;font-weight: bold; }  /*Teal headeline*/
.style2 {font: 14px Arial, Helvetica, sans-serif; color: #312e2e;font-weight: bold; line-height: 18px; }	/*body*/
.style3 {font: 18px Arial, Helvetica, sans-serif; color: #312e2e; font-weight: bold;}  /*grey Home headers*/
.style4 {font-family :Arial,helvetica; ;font-size : 16px; color : #08727c;text-decoration: none;font-weight: bold;}  /*home page flavors - orange text*/
.style5 {font-family :Arial,helvetica; ;font-size : 14px; color : #000000;text-decoration: none;font-weight: bold;}  /*home page flavors - orange text*/

.mainHeaderTitles {font-family :Verdana, Arial,helvetica; ;font-size : 30px; color : #01909e;text-decoration: none;}

.footer {font-family: Tahoma, Arial, Helvetica;	font-size: 11px;	color: #312e2e;}

.contactForm {font-family :Trebuchet MS,Arial,helvetica; ;font-size : 12px; color : #000000;text-decoration: none;font-weight: bold;}  /*home page flavors - orange text*/


.inputBox
{
background-color: #FFFFFF; 
border: 1px solid #86a2cc; 
font-family : Trebuchet MS, Verdana,tahoma,Arial;
font-size : 11px;
}



.p {font: 14px Arial, Helvetica, sans-serif; color: #666666; line-height: 18px; }	/*body*/


td.teamName { font-family : Tahoma,Verdana,Arial;font-size : 12px; color : #008f9d;}
td.teamTitle {font-family : Tahoma,Verdana,Arial;font-size : 12px; color : #000000; }
td.teamBody {font-family : Tahoma,Verdana,Arial;font-size : 12px; color : #000000; }
td.teamFlavors {font-family : Tahoma,Verdana,Arial;font-size : 12px; color : #000000; }


table.bodytable {
padding:5px;
color: #000000;	
}



.close			{font-family : Verdana,tahoma,Arial;font-size : 10px; color : #FF0000;text-decoration: underline;}
a.close			{font-family : Verdana,tahoma,Arial;font-size : 10px; color : #FF0000;text-decoration: underline;}
a.close:hover	{font-family: Verdana,tahoma,Arial;font-size : 10px; color : #000000;text-decoration: underline;}

